Sinopse

Offering a novel perspective, this book explores the interplay of ICT and language learning within the context of technological and social change, from the printing press to the mobile phone. It considers how technological advances, through their impact on communication, language and education, affect not only how languages are learnt, but also what kind of language is learnt. The approach highlights both the multifaceted and complex nature of language study and its evolutionary dimension.
